🤔 What Are Spinal Bone Spurs Anyway?

Let’s break it down: Bone spurs (or osteophytes) are your body’s way of saying, "Hey, I’m trying to fix something!" 📝 These bony growths often form as a response to wear-and-tear in joints, especially if you’ve got osteoarthritis knocking on your door. While they’re not inherently painful, they can press on nerves or muscles, causing discomfort that ranges from mild annoyance to full-blown agony. 😖 So how do we tackle this? Let’s dive in!


💪 Physical Therapy: The Secret Weapon Against Pain

Physical therapy isn’t just for athletes recovering from injuries—it’s also a game-changer for managing spinal bone spur pain. Think of PT as your personal trainer-meets-life coach who helps strengthen your core, improve flexibility, and reduce strain on those pesky spurs. 🏋️‍♀️ Plus, exercises like swimming or yoga can be gentle yet effective ways to keep moving without aggravating symptoms. 🌟 Looking Ahead: Prevention Is Key

The ultimate goal here isn’t just treating pain but preventing future flare-ups. Maintaining a healthy weight, practicing proper posture, and avoiding repetitive motions are all steps toward protecting your spine long-term. Remember, small changes add up over time.
